在网络安全领域,协议端口是网络通信的重要组成部分,掌握其记忆技巧和使用扫描工具的技能对于网络规划设计师至关重要。本文将介绍“协议端口联想记忆法”,总结易混淆端口的区分方法,并附上端口扫描工具Nmap的常用命令示例。
一、协议端口联想记忆法
面对众多协议端口,如何高效记忆成为一大挑战。这里推荐一种“协议端口联想记忆法”,通过关联记忆,让复杂的端口号变得简单易记。
例如,HTTPS的默认端口是443,可以将其联想为HTTP的默认端口80加上363(即443-80=363),这样既记住了HTTPS的端口,又复习了HTTP的端口。
类似地,可以联想SSH的默认端口22为“S”开头,因为SSH是Secure Shell的缩写,而“S”在字母表中排第19位,再加上3就是22(即19+3=22)。这种联想记忆法可以帮助你快速记住多个协议端口。
二、易混淆端口的区分方法
在网络安全领域,有些协议端口的编号非常接近,容易混淆。以下是一些易混淆端口的区分方法:
-
LDAP与LDAPS:LDAP(轻量目录访问协议)的默认端口是389,而LDAPS(LDAP over SSL)的默认端口是636。可以通过记住“LDAPS多了一个S,所以端口也多了一个300多”来区分。
-
FTP与SFTP:FTP(文件传输协议)的控制端口是21,数据端口是20;而SFTP(SSH文件传输协议)的默认端口是22。可以通过理解SFTP是SSH的一部分,而SSH的默认端口是22来记忆。
-
SMTP与SMTPS:SMTP(简单邮件传输协议)的默认端口是25,而SMTPS(SMTP over SSL)的默认端口是465或587。可以通过记住“SMTPS多了一个S,所以端口也变了”来区分。
三、Nmap常用命令示例
Nmap是一款强大的端口扫描工具,以下是一些常用命令示例:
- 扫描指定IP地址的所有端口:
nmap -p- <IP地址>
这个命令将扫描指定IP地址的所有端口,并输出结果。
- 扫描指定IP地址的特定端口:
nmap -p <端口号> <IP地址>
这个命令将扫描指定IP地址的特定端口,并输出结果。例如,要扫描IP地址为192.168.1.1的主机的80端口,可以使用命令nmap -p 80 192.168.1.1
。
- 扫描指定网段的所有主机和端口:
nmap -sS -p- <网段>
这个命令将使用SYN扫描方式扫描指定网段的所有主机和端口,并输出结果。例如,要扫描192.168.1.0/24网段的所有主机和端口,可以使用命令nmap -sS -p- 192.168.1.0/24
。
- 扫描指定主机的开放端口并输出详细信息:
nmap -sV <IP地址>
这个命令将扫描指定主机的开放端口,并输出每个端口的详细信息,包括服务名称、版本号等。
通过掌握“协议端口联想记忆法”,总结易混淆端口的区分方法,并熟练使用Nmap等端口扫描工具,你将能够更好地应对网络安全领域的挑战。希望这些技巧和方法能对你的备考过程有所帮助。
喵呜刷题:让学习像火箭一样快速,快来微信扫码,体验免费刷题服务,开启你的学习加速器!